Phu Yen seamen gain big tuna catch

Fishermen in central Phu Yen province are enjoying a productive spell, with 70 percent of tuna fishing boats bringing back 1.5-3 tonnes of ocean tuna each voyage.

According to Captain Nguyen Ngoc Ryfrom the Tuy Hoa border post, more than 80 trawlers of fishermen livingin Ward 6 and Phu Dong Ward have anchored and enjoyed higher yields ofthe fish than that on the first days of this year.

PhanThuan, chairman of the Ward 6’s Fishing Union, said 70 percent of tunafishing vessels made profits of 70-80 million VND (3,290-3,760 USD) fromeach offshore fishing voyage.

Although the price of tunadropped to 135,000 VND (6.34 USD) per kilogram from 170,000 VND (7.99USD), local fishermen still made a profit thanks to their additionalcatches of other fishes to make up costs for the fishing voyages, whichnormally last for 20-25 days.

According to the provincialDepartment of Agriculture and Rural Development, Phu Yen’s catch ofocean tuna has reached 1,900 tonnes since the beginning of the fishingcrop.-VNA
